Description:

After a young woman, Marion Crane, receives a large amount of money originally intended for a deposit, she decides to go on a lifestyle change and leaves Phoenix, Arizona for California. But tired as she is, she decides to stop for a rest at the Bates Motel on the old highway, close to Fairview, CA. She is unaware of the motel's owner, Norman Bates, and can't figure out why he still lives with his mother. And now her sister, Lila and Marion's boyfriend can't figure out why Marion is missing. Maybe if they ask Norman, or his Mother, they will find out why...


Biography for Anne Heche

Birth name
Anne Celeste Heche
Date of birth
25 May 1969
Aurora, Ohio, USA

Trivia

Surname is pronounced "Haytch".

(1997 - 2000) Partner of Ellen DeGeneres.

Had a 2 year relationship with Steve Martin.

(1998) Chosen by People Magazine as one of the 50 most beautiful people in the world.

One of four children, she has a brother and two sisters.

Her father Don, a choir director, died at 45 of AIDS in 1983.

Her sister Susan Bergman has written a book about their family and their father called "Anonymity" (1998).

Went to Ocean City High School, Ocean City, NJ.

(1999) Announced that she intends to marry Ellen DeGeneres if Vermont carries through its plans to legalize gay marriages.

(August 2000) Split with partner Ellen DeGeneres after being together for 3 1/2 years.

(5 September 2001) During an interview with Barbara Walters, Heche stated that she has an alter ego named Celestia.

2 March 2002: 7 pound boy, Homer Heche Laffoon, born in Los Angeles. The baby is the first child for Heche and husband, cameraman Coleman (Coley) Laffoon.

4 September 2001: Autobiography "Call Me Crazy" released. Heche wrote it in just six weeks.

Heche's family moved 11 times before she was 12.
